Johnson & Johnson

Director, Health Care Compliance Officer

Johnson & Johnson

Director, Health Care Compliance Officer at Johnson & Johnson leading healthcare compliance initiatives in U.S. Innovative Medicine.

Posted 5/26/2026full-timeHorsham • New Jersey, Pennsylvania • 🇺🇸 United StatesLead💰 $150,000 - $258,750 per yearWebsite

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Provide strategic healthcare compliance leadership for the U.S. Innovative Medicine business
  • Serve as a thought partner to senior leaders, advising on complex business initiatives
  • Oversee and support business activities based on risk profiling
  • Partner with commercial, medical, regulatory, legal, finance, and other stakeholders
  • Lead enterprise- and business-level risk assessments, root cause analyses, mitigation planning
  • Drive a culture of credo-based decision-making
  • Advance compliance by design, partnering with the business
  • Ensure appropriate governance and issue management
  • Partner with colleagues for timely and accurate fulfillment of government reporting obligations
  • Manage, coach, and develop direct reports

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Bachelor’s degree required
  • Minimum 10+ years of business-related experience
  • 5+ years of experience in healthcare compliance
  • 2+ years of people management experience
  • Strong knowledge of U.S. healthcare compliance laws
  • Experience designing, implementing, or evolving compliance programs
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Proven ability to build strong partnerships across a matrixed organization
  • Strong analytical skills

Benefits

Comp & perks
  • Health insurance
  • Consolidated retirement plan (pension)
  • Savings plan (401(k))
  • Long-term incentive program
  • Vacation – 120 hours per calendar year
  • Sick time - 40 hours per calendar year; 48 hours for Colorado residents; 56 hours for Washington residents
  • Holiday pay – 13 days per calendar year
  • Work, Personal and Family Time - up to 40 hours per calendar year
  • Parental Leave – 480 hours within one year of child’s birth/adoption/foster care
  • Bereavement Leave – 240 hours for immediate family member; 40 hours for extended family member per calendar year
  • Caregiver Leave – 80 hours in a 52-week rolling period
  • Volunteer Leave – 32 hours per calendar year
  • Military Spouse Time-Off – 80 hours per calendar year
